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2020-13594 : Exploit Details and Defense Strategies

Learn about CVE-2020-13594, a vulnerability in Bluetooth Low Energy (BLE) controller implementation in Espressif ESP-IDF 4.2 allowing denial of service attacks. Find mitigation steps and prevention measures.

Bluetooth Low Energy (BLE) controller implementation in Espressif ESP-IDF 4.2 and earlier allows attackers to cause a denial of service via crafted packets.

Understanding CVE-2020-13594

The vulnerability in the Bluetooth Low Energy (BLE) controller implementation in Espressif ESP-IDF 4.2 and earlier can lead to a denial of service (DoS) attack.

What is CVE-2020-13594?

The Bluetooth Low Energy (BLE) controller implementation in Espressif ESP-IDF 4.2 and earlier (for ESP32 devices) does not properly restrict the channel map field of the connection request packet on reception, enabling attackers within radio range to trigger a crash by sending a malicious packet.

The Impact of CVE-2020-13594

This vulnerability allows attackers within radio range to exploit the BLE controller implementation, potentially causing a denial of service (DoS) by crashing the system through specially crafted packets.

Technical Details of CVE-2020-13594

The technical details of the CVE-2020-13594 vulnerability are as follows:

Vulnerability Description

        The issue lies in the improper restriction of the channel map field in the connection request packet.

Affected Systems and Versions

        Espressif ESP-IDF 4.2 and earlier for ESP32 devices are affected by this vulnerability.

Exploitation Mechanism

        Attackers within radio range can exploit this vulnerability by sending a crafted packet to the BLE controller, causing a denial of service (DoS) by crashing the system.

Mitigation and Prevention

To mitigate the CVE-2020-13594 vulnerability, consider the following steps:

Immediate Steps to Take

        Update to the latest version of Espressif ESP-IDF to patch the vulnerability.
        Implement network segmentation to limit the impact of potential attacks.

Long-Term Security Practices

        Regularly monitor and update firmware to address security vulnerabilities.
        Conduct security assessments and penetration testing to identify and remediate weaknesses.

Patching and Updates

        Stay informed about security advisories and promptly apply patches released by Espressif to address vulnerabilities.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now